Quebecor accuses Radio-Canada of undue preference over Tou.tv

Media | 01/17/2020 2:11 pm EST

Quebecor Inc. wants CBC/Radio-Canada to shut down its subscription streaming service ICI Tou.tv Extra, and has filed a Part 1 application with the CRTC. In a Friday morning press release, Quebecor -- which runs its own French-language subscription streaming service, Club Illico -- said that it is not challenging the free version of the service, but is taking issue with the charging of $6.99/month subscription fees and offering that subscription service for free to some TV subscribers.
